Pleasant Valley is a public 9-hole golf course in Payne, Ohio, USA, within the broader USA - Midwest golf landscape. The course follows a parkland layout, a style commonly associated with inland golf, tree-lined corridors, more sheltered playing conditions, and a routing that tends to reward placement from tee to green. It is attributed to Morris Brady and traces its origins to 1960, details that place the property within an earlier generation of American course design and give it a profile consistent with many long-established courses of the same era.

| Hole |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 6 | 7 | 8 | 9 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Yds | 505 | 271 | 380 | 437 | 408 | 170 | 355 | 308 | 166 |
| Par | 5 | 4 | 4 | 5 | 4 | 3 | 4 | 4 | 3 |
| HCP | 1 | 5 | 6 | 7 | 8 | 4 | 2 | 9 | 3 |
